Description of The Duke of Clarence
This is a modern British pub with all the quality and style that you would expect in Kensington, coupled with the comfort, delightful look and fine, fresh food that are synonymous with the quintessential Geronimo pub. Perfectly set in the oldest licensed building on Old Brompton Road, The Duke of Clarence was previously more renowned in the area for its brunch, burgers and bonhomie. However, it has now also gained an impressive reputation for the extensive wine list, selected by John Clevely and featuring everything from smooth classic reds to aromatic whites. Alongside a great range of beers, The Duke of Clarence can certainly satisfy the demanding residents of Kensington and beyond. Whether it's to watch the sport of the day or just watch the world pass by through the huge open windows, this is a superb spot for both stylish diners and drinkers.
